srayner / cobalt
ICT资产管理与项目管理应用程序
Requires
- php: >=5.6
- doctrine/doctrine-orm-module: ^0.9.2
- mso/idna-convert: ~0.9
- neilime/zf2-twb-bundle: ^2.6
- phpwhois/phpwhois: dev-master
- srayner/civaccess: dev-master
- srayner/civmail: dev-master
- srayner/civuser: dev-master
- twig/twig: ~1.0
- zendframework/zendframework: 2.5.1
Requires (Dev)
- phpunit/phpunit: ^5.4
- squizlabs/php_codesniffer: 2.*
This package is not auto-updated.
Last update: 2024-09-14 19:36:47 UTC
README
Cobalt应用程序
Cobalt是资产管理、项目管理和支持帮助台的完整ICT解决方案。它可以通过LDAP连接器连接到Active Directory以提取用户和计算机信息。
目前它可以管理用户、硬件、软件、项目、域名和支持工单。还有一个常见问题解答部分。
安装
注意此应用程序要求您已安装ldap php扩展。
mkdir cobalt
cd cobalt
git clone https://github.com/srayner/cobalt.git .
php composer.phar install
安装后任务
-
创建名为cobalt的数据库,并在 \data\db_schema 文件夹中执行SQL脚本以创建数据库表结构。
-
将 \config\autoload\local.php.dist 重命名为移除 .dist 扩展名。然后修改此文件顶部的配置以适应您的本地安装。
仪表板
仪表板提供了系统的概览。它显示了重要系统实体的总数以及监控网络接口的当前状态。
用户
您可以添加、编辑、搜索、查看和删除用户。您还可以从Microsoft Active Directory导入/更新用户信息。
硬件
您可以添加、编辑、搜索、查看和删除硬件。有两种特殊类型的硬件;
- 计算机
- 打印机
计算机具有各种附加属性,包括操作系统和逻辑磁盘信息,可以使用WMI从计算机中提取。您可以通过远程桌面或VNC获取对计算机的远程访问。还可以轻松访问计算机的C$共享以浏览远程计算机的硬盘。
打印机具有附加属性,如打印速度、打印质量等。打印机还可以有相关的消耗品。消耗品具有属性,如;类型、供应商和库存数量。
软件
软件有制造商、类型和类别。软件可以有相关的许可证以及相关的安装。
项目
项目可以有关联的里程碑,里程碑可以有关联的任务。查看Cobalt网站
域名
可以添加域名,然后可以从WhoIs数据库中提取DNS记录的信息。
常见问题解答
有一个简单的常见问题解答部分。
开发路线图
帮助台模块、硬件监控和通知目前都在进行中。
其他可能性包括;
- 变更管理模块
- 详细的问题和解决方案。
- 服务监控